The Biafran National Guard has claimed responsibility for the attack on Abia State Police Command Headquarters, Umuahia, on Monday.

Anaedoonline.ng had earlier reported that gunmen disguised in military camouflage and using gun trucks opened fire at the policemen on duty in front of 28 Police Mobile Force beside the State Command Headquarters, Bende Road, Umuahia.

The attack led to the death of one Inspector Friday Adama of 17 Police Mobile Force, Akure on Operation Restore Peace special duty in the Command.

BNG in a statement released through its Head of Media, Elemamba Eberechukwu, disclosed that the police headquarters was attacked to question the Commissioner of Police, Janet Agbede over the recent attacks on Biafrans.

The group further stated that it has no intention to kill anyone at the station.
